Should Britain Now Join the Euro?

Jun 5th, 2008 | By Merryn Somerset Webb | Category: International Investing

The pessimists warning of a short-lived, or chronically weak, single currency at the European Central Bank’s inception in June 1998 have so far been “spectacularly wrong”, as Edward Hadas notes on Breakingviews.
